职位描述
您准备好获得在您职位内成长和发展职业所需的技能和经验 - 我们为您提供了完美的软件工程机会。
作为摩根大通的 软件工程师 III,您将负责为交易台开发复杂的交易系统,该交易台是公司中收入和产品覆盖面最大的交易台之一。我们的交易员分布在全球,参与多种金融产品,从普通外汇现货到复杂的利率期权。我们的技术团队与业务用户紧密合作,设计并开发用于资产定价、交易和风险管理功能的核心软件应用程序。
工作职责
• 与高级工程师和研究人员合作,为行业最大的交易台之一开发实时、高度可扩展的交易系统。
• 在有限指导下,使用至少一种编程语言的语法编写安全且高质量的代码。
• 参与摩根大通旗舰技术产品 Athena 的开发,这是全球最大的 Python 代码库之一(超过 5000 万行代码)。
• 与量化研究人员和业务用户合作,记录功能需求。
• 使用 Python 和 React/Java Script 编写高质量代码,构建直接供业务用户使用的最佳应用程序。
• 通过与业务用户密切合作,获得定价、风险和交易管理功能的经验。
• 学习并应用系统流程、方法论和技能,以开发安全、稳定的代码和系统。
所需资格、能力和技能
• 在软件工程概念方面的正式培训或认证以及 3 年以上的应用经验。
• 在系统设计、应用开发、测试和操作稳定性方面的实践经验。
• 在大型企业环境中使用一种或多种现代编程语言和数据库查询语言开发、调试和维护代码的经验。
• 对算法、数据结构、设计模式和面向对象编程(OOP)有深入了解。
• 精通一种或多种编程语言(Python、C++、Java)。
• 熟悉敏捷方法论,如 CI/CD、应用程序弹性和安全性。
• 对技术学科(例如:云计算、人工智能、机器学习、移动等)内的软件应用程序和技术流程有新兴知识。
优先资格、能力和技能
• 熟悉现代前端技术:React.JS。
• 对算法、数据结构、设计模式和面向对象编程(OOP)有深入了解。
• 精通一种或多种编程语言(Python、C++、Java)。
• 虽然不要求有金融经验,但对学习金融产品和市场有浓厚兴趣是必不可少的。
关于我们
摩根大通是历史最悠久的金融机构之一,向数百万消费者、小型企业以及众多世界上最著名的企业、机构和政府客户提供创新的金融解决方案,品牌包括 J.P. 摩根和 Chase。我们的历史超过 200 年,今天我们在投资银行、消费者和小型企业银行、商业银行、金融交易处理和资产管理领域处于领先地位。
我们提供具有竞争力的总奖励方案,包括根据角色、经验、技能和地点确定的基本工资。符合条件的角色可能会获得基于佣金的薪酬和/或酌情激励补偿,以现金和/或可放弃的股票形式支付,以表彰个人成就和贡献。我们还提供一系列福利和项目,以满足员工的需求,具体取决于资格。这些福利包括全面的医疗保险、现场健康和保健中心、退休储蓄计划、备份儿童保育、学费报销、心理健康支持、财务辅导等。在招聘过程中将提供有关总薪酬和福利的更多详细信息。
我们认识到我们的员工是我们的力量,他们为我们的全球劳动力带来的多样化才能与我们的成功直接相关。我们是一个平等机会的雇主,重视公司内的多样性和包容性。我们不基于任何受保护的属性进行歧视,包括种族、宗教、肤色、国籍、性别、性取向、性别认同、性别表现、年龄、婚姻或退伍军人身份、怀孕或残疾,或任何其他根据适用法律受保护的基础。我们还为申请者和员工的宗教实践和信仰、心理健康或身体残疾需求提供合理的便利。有关请求便利的更多信息,请访问我们的常见问题解答。
摩根大通公司是一个平等机会雇主,包括残疾/退伍军人
关于团队
企业与投资银行是投资银行、批发支付、市场和证券服务的全球领导者。世界上最重要的公司、政府和机构信任我们在 100 多个国家的业务。我们提供战略建议、筹集资本、管理风险并在全球市场中提供流动性。